#149c0a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#149c0a is composed of 7.8% red, 61.2% green and 3.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 93.6% yellow and 38.8% black. It has a hue angle of 115.9 degrees, a saturation of 88% and a lightness of 32.5%. #149c0a color hex could be obtained by blending #28ff14 with #003900. Closest websafe color is: #009900.

Shades and Tints of #149c0a

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010901 is the darkest color, while #f6fef5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#149c0a

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#515650 is the less saturated color, while #0ea204 is the most saturated one.
